Anglo-Saxon Strap end
Description
English: Cast copper-alloy one-piece strap-end. Flat, convex-sided shaft, split end with two rivets. Vestigial animal-mask terminal. No trace of decoration on the shank, apart from a horizontal line below the rivets, perhaps to define the extent of a panel. Surfaces worn very smooth. Even, pale green dull patina. L: 41.5 W: 2.5-13 (fair)
Depicted place (County of findspot) Hampshire
Date between 750 and 950

The Portable Antiquities Scheme (PAS) is a voluntary programme run by the United Kingdom government to record the increasing numbers of small finds of archaeological interest found by members of the public. The scheme started in 1997 and now covers most of England and Wales. Finds are published at https://finds.org.uk
